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6448941264 025500 9229 21771 283204
57984 04
57984 04
9928 0070267581 11436259669
All about undefined
Interested in learning more?
57984 04
9928 0070267581 11436259669
See more
3777 9580297304
261426 09482 8958
See more
468 78
931033530 761649 74
See more